I took this book off my wishlist after checking it out at the library. In my opinion, there are better and more extensive books out there (and in my personal library). Gives some recipes and some crafts. Even tells you how to milk a cow - though, again, you would need to buy a more specific book if you wanted to actually raise animals. There is some good information, but the other books in my collection cover most, if not all, in much more detail. Not for the serious homesteader or even hobbyist. For a little bit of everything (that also goes into more depth), one would be better getting Carla Emery's Encyclopedia of Country Living.
